Red Deer Podiatrist & Foot Clinic

Specialists at The Foot Institute – Red Deer specialize in the surgical and medical treatment of the ankle and foot. Foot Institute Doctors put in approximately 10 years in higher education, the first 4 years in undergraduate studies to obtain a Bachelors Degree, and the second 4 years in Medical School to get a Podiatric Medical Degree. Podiatric Medical School resembles traditional medical school and in fact a number of podiatry training programs are located within these institutions. After obtaining a Podiatric Medial Degree, Podiatrists at the Foot Institute finish a hospital "internship" or residency for another one to three years.

At the completion of the internship or post degree residency, our Foot doctors have received significant health care training with a focus on problems involving the ankles and feet. Foot Institute Doctors are qualified to treat difficulties ranging from usual disorders such as fungal and ingrown toenails, to those which are even more perplexing for example, clubfoot, bunions, or reconstructive surgery of the foot. Doctors at the Foot Institute have substantial surgical instruction which give them the skill necessary to carry out surgery on those conditions that are best handled through surgical treatment.

Our Doctors also have a comprehensive practical knowledge and understanding of biomechanics, which is the study of the forces which the legs and feet endure as we walk, run or perform other activities. Learning about biomechanics and gait deviations makes it possible for a Podiatrist to design footwear and orthotics that can offer pain relief and prevent a large number of complications which the feet routinely experience.
